Where Are Menai Cottages Snowdonia Located?
The cottages are spread across North Wales, with some of the most popular locations including the Menai Strait, Menai Bridge, Anglesey, and areas near Snowdonia National Park.
The Menai Strait is a narrow tidal waterway that separates the Isle of Anglesey from the Welsh mainland. Many cottages here boast stunning views of the strait, allowing guests to enjoy beautiful morning and evening scenery directly from their windows.
Menai Bridge, a historic town named after its famous suspension bridge, provides local amenities, riverside walks, and charming pubs. It is an excellent hub for exploring both Anglesey and the surrounding Snowdonia region.
Anglesey is renowned for its golden beaches, coastal paths, and scenic seaside towns. Many cottages offer direct access to beaches, cycling routes, and walking paths, making it ideal for visitors who want to experience both the coast and countryside.
Finally, Snowdonia National Park is only a short drive from most cottages. The park is famous for its mountain trails, hiking paths, lakes, and diverse wildlife, with Snowdon, the highest peak in Wales, attracting hikers from around the world. This strategic location allows guests to enjoy both mountains and sea within a single trip, creating a holiday experience that is uniquely versatile and captivating.

Booking Tips for Menai Cottages Snowdonia
To ensure a smooth and enjoyable stay, there are a few tips worth following. Booking early is crucial, especially during summer months and school holidays, as cottages can fill up quickly. Knowing the exact location of your chosen property is also essential, as some cottages are closer to Anglesey while others are nearer to the mountains.
Checking the amenities before booking can prevent surprises; Wi-Fi availability, parking, pet policies, and bed arrangements differ from cottage to cottage. Additionally, comparing prices between direct owners and rental websites can help you find the best deals and make the most of your holiday budget. By planning ahead, you can maximize comfort and enjoyment during your stay.
Exploring the Local Area
The Menai Snowdonia region offers much more than just cottages. Menai Bridge Town provides charming local eateries, riverside walks, and historic points of interest. Anglesey beaches such as Newborough and Benllech offer perfect spots for swimming, sunbathing, or coastal walks.
For those seeking adventure, there are numerous boating opportunities, including rib rides and wildlife tours along the Menai Strait. History enthusiasts can explore Beaumaris Castle or take a walk along the Caernarfon Town walls. Visitors can easily combine relaxation and exploration, making each day unique and memorable.
